Owning an LG oven with steam functionality offers incredible convenience, but sometimes even the best appliances can show error codes that leave you scratching your head. One common issue users encounter is Error Code F24. This error specifically points to a problem with the steam thermistor, a small but crucial component that monitors and regulates the steam temperature inside your oven. Understanding what this error means and how to address it can save time, frustration, and possibly a repair bill.

Understanding the F24 Error and Steam Thermistor Issues

The steam thermistor acts like a sensor for your oven’s steam system. It ensures the steam heater operates at the correct temperature and prevents overheating or underperformance. When the thermistor detects unusual readings or loses electrical continuity, the oven triggers Error Code F24 to alert you.

DIY Troubleshooting Steps

Before calling a professional, there are some steps you can safely try at home.

  1. Stop the Oven: Immediately turn off the steam function to prevent further damage.
  2. Inspect the Thermistor: Look for visible signs of damage, corrosion, or disconnected wires.
  3. Check Connections: Ensure that all wires are firmly attached and in good condition.
  4. Measure Resistance: Using a multimeter, check the resistance of the thermistor according to your oven’s manual. Readings outside the expected range indicate a faulty thermistor.
  5. Reset the Oven: Turn the oven off and back on to see if the error clears. Sometimes a simple reset resolves minor sensor glitches.

Always make sure the oven is completely powered off and unplugged before performing inspections. Safety comes first.

When to Seek Professional Help

If the F24 error persists despite following these steps, it’s time to call a qualified technician. Professionals can perform a detailed diagnostic, replace the thermistor if necessary, and ensure the steam system is functioning safely. Attempting complex repairs without proper tools or knowledge may cause further damage.
